The CX500M is semi-modular. There usually isn't any functional difference between a semi-modular and fully modular. The permanently attached cables you will need to use anyway.

I wasn't familiar with that case. Bifenix makes the information on PSU size difficult to determine, but it appears that 160mm is the maximum length, though cramped. The Fractal is is 160mm (Unit Measurements:150*86*160)
so hopefully you can stuff it in there. The EVGA 550 G2 is 165mm- too long!
